Welcome to our video on Washington lease and landlord tenant laws as a landlord its essential to know your rights and responsibilities to manage your rental property well with that in mind here are some important landlord tenant laws in The Evergreen State the lease agreement is the foundation of the landlord tenant relationship its a legally binding contract between a landlord and tenant that sets the terms of the rental relationship the most common type of lease agreement is a one-year fixed term lease that terminates at the end of the lease term this is often referred to as a standard lease agreement beyond the basic terms of the lease there are some additional things that Washington landlords must include in their lease landlords must provide tenants with the name and contact information of any agents authorized to enter the property if the landlord doesnt live in the state the lease must name an agent that lives in the county where the property is located a name and address for
